How does one attain true righteousness according to the Bible?

Answered in 1 source

True righteousness is attained through faith in Jesus Christ, who is our righteousness before God.

According to the Bible, true righteousness is not based on our own works but is given to us through faith in Jesus Christ. Philippians 3:9 states, 'And be found in him, not having mine own righteousness, which is of the law, but that which is through the faith of Christ, the righteousness which is of God by faith.' This signifies that we receive Christ’s righteousness by believing in Him and His finished work on the cross. Our belief enables us to be counted as righteous before God, underscoring that salvation is a gift, not a result of our merit.
Scripture References: Philippians 3:9, 2 Corinthians 5:21
